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: Аппроксимация сигнала
Форум разработчиков электроники ELECTRONIX.ru > Цифровая обработка сигналов - ЦОС (DSP) > Алгоритмы ЦОС (DSP)
rx9cim
Здравствуйте!
У меня следующая задача:
имеет спектр мощности сигнала, вычисляется из результатов комплексного ДПФ.
Далее путем экспоненциального усреднения я усредняю по времени мощность каждого бина.
Накапливаю статистику для подавления зеркального канала в SDR приемнике, вычисляю параметры для коррекции бинов, в которых долгое время был зарегистрирован сигнал и набраны статистики.
Вопрос вот в чем: После набора нужного количества статистики я вижу, что в некоторых бинах был сигнал и по ним набрана статистика, а в некоторых - нет. Мне необходимо аппроксимировать коэффициенты коррекции для бинов, где сигнала не было. Как это сделать?
т.е. я имею последовательность, например 1 9 8 5 6 7 X X X X 5. Как мне найти эти X ?
Как найти аппроксимирующую функцию?
Линейная аппроксимация не интересует.
petrov
А как автор обосновывает необходимость этой операции?
rx9cim
Автор , то бишь я, обосновываю это так:
Значение бина учитывается при наборе статистики только если его значение превышает порог в 3.3 раза (хотя порог может быть произвольный). Чтобы в итоге можно было принимать сигналы с соотношением с/ш 5дБ мне для этого и нужна в конечном счете аппроксимация.
petrov
Цитата(rx9cim @ Jan 30 2013, 20:14) *
Автор , то бишь я, обосновываю это так:
Значение бина учитывается при наборе статистики только если его значение превышает порог в 3.3 раза (хотя порог может быть произвольный). Чтобы в итоге можно было принимать сигналы с соотношением с/ш 5дБ мне для этого и нужна в конечном счете аппроксимация.


Что происходит если никаких порогов не делать? Чем например шум МШУ хуже сигнала, он так же через квадратурный демодулятор проходит и зеркальные каналы становятся коррелированными, пусть алгоритм компенсации себе работает, появится сигнал, ещё лучше будет работать?
rx9cim
Шум - случайный процесс. Применение алгоритма для него нецелесообразно - поскольку в алгоритме корректируются как основной, так и зеркальный канал.
alex_os
Цитата(rx9cim @ Jan 30 2013, 17:32) *
Накапливаю статистику для подавления зеркального канала в SDR приемнике, вычисляю параметры для коррекции бинов, в которых долгое время был зарегистрирован сигнал и набраны статистики.


Это вроде какой-то постобработки с целью скомпенсировать не идеальность квадратурного демодулятора, side-band rejection улучшить?
rx9cim
Да. Не только демодулятора, но в первую очередь ФЧХ АЦП аудиокодека.
alex_os
Цитата(rx9cim @ Jan 31 2013, 10:16) *
Да. Не только демодулятора, но в первую очередь ФЧХ АЦП аудиокодека.

Т.е компенсируется разбегание фаз квадратур на различных частотах...
А ссылочку на алгоритм не дадите?
rx9cim
Вот один вариант:
http://www.dxatlas.com/rocky/advanced.asp
Вот второй:
http://www.cqham.ru/forum/attachment.php?a...mp;d=1347269543

Все-таки прошу дельных советов по теме
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.